How should your resume be How Should Your Resume be Formatted?
A well-formatted resume should be simple to read and navigate. Use clear headings to differentiate sections like work experience, education, and skills. Avoid fancy fonts or format, as it could distract from the main points of your resume.
Key Points to Consider When formatting your resume
- Make use of bullet point breaks to break up lengthy paragraphs
- Check that there is enough white space between sections.
- Maintain your font size between 10pt-12pt.
- Follow the same format for formatting.

Making a Strong Resume
The process of creating a solid resume requires time and effort but it can significantly increase your chances of securing an interview for your desired job. Here are a few key points to create a successful resume:
Find Your Skills:
You must identify your core competencies, skills, capabilities or other work-related qualities that distinguish you from other candidates who apply for similar positions.
Tailor Your Resume:
Make sure that your resume is tailored to the position you’re seeking, and includes relevant experience and skills.
Highlight Your Highlight Your Achievements:
Highlight your achievements and successes at previous roles. This can be quantified in depth – for example, surpassing sales targets or completing projects within budget and ahead of timeline. Statistics, percentage increases, results can aid.

Common Questions and Answers
What’s the point of the resume?
A resume is a form of documentation that outlines your qualifications such as work experience, academic background and achievements. It provides an initial outline for employers who are looking to determine if you’re a good fit for an opening.
What is the importance to customize your resume to each job?
It’s important to tailor your resume based on the specific requirements of the job announcement. If you don’t customize your resume, it may not effectively demonstrate why you’re the ideal applicant for the job.
Do I need to include all of my experience for my resume?
It is important to provide only relevant work experience in your CV. Focus on experiences that pertain to the job you are seeking rather than listing every past job.
What can I put in my personal information or interests in my cover letter?
Information about your the date of birth, marital status and interests should be be avoided as they can potentially be used to create discrimination in the hiring process. Be sure to use only professional information pertaining to your work experience and education.
How should I utilize in submitting my resume electronically?
When you submit electronic resumes is recommended to save them either as pdf or Word document using the proper name convention for the file. Be sure that the formatting is consistent and easy be read on any tool or device is used by potential employers.
